| 1 | Transgenic expression of MIR122 in hepatocytes of mice with ethanol-induced liver disease and advanced fibrosis significantly reduced serum levels of alanine aminotransferase (ALT) and liver steatosis and fibrosis, compared with mice given injections of the control vector. | Ethanol | microRNA 122 | Mus musculus |
| 2 | Ethanol feeding reduced expression of pri-MIR122 by increasing expression of the spliced form of the transcription factor grainyhead like transcription factor 2 (GRHL2) in liver tissues from mice. | Ethanol | microRNA 122 | Mus musculus |
| 3 | Mice given injections of the anti-MIR122 before ethanol feeding had increased steatosis, inflammation, and serum levels of alanine aminotransferase compared with mice given a control vector. | Ethanol | microRNA 122 | Mus musculus |
| 4 | Expression of an anti-MIR122 worsened the severity of liver damage following ethanol feeding in mice. | Ethanol | microRNA 122 | Mus musculus |
| 5 | MIR122 appears to protect the liver from ethanol-induced damage by reducing levels of HIF1alpha. | Ethanol | microRNA 122 | Mus musculus |
